java如何实现监听

java如何实现监听

作者:William Gu发布时间:2026-01-29阅读时长:0 分钟阅读次数:14

用户关注问题

Q
什么是Java中的监听机制?

我听说Java中有监听机制,这具体指的是什么?

A

Java监听机制概述

Java中的监听机制是一种设计模式,用于实现事件驱动编程。当某个事件发生时,监听器对象会自动收到通知并作出响应,常见于GUI编程和事件处理。

Q
如何在Java中创建自定义事件监听器?

我想在Java程序中定义自己的事件以及相应的监听器,该如何实现?

A

创建自定义事件监听器的步骤

要创建自定义事件监听器,需要先定义一个事件类继承自java.util.EventObject,然后定义监听接口包含事件处理方法,最后在事件源中注册监听器并在合适的时机触发事件。

Q
Java标准库中常用的监听接口有哪些?

我想了解一下Java自带的常用监听接口,以便选择适合的来处理事件。

A

Java常用监听接口介绍

Java标准库中提供了多种监听接口,比如ActionListener处理按钮点击事件,MouseListener处理鼠标事件,KeyListener处理键盘事件,PropertyChangeListener监听属性变化等。